The Matterhorn Terminal Täsch is the central pivotal point for automobiles. In Täsch, they must be parked before guests continue the journey to Zermatt comfortably in the shuttle train. Alternative for travel to Zermatt: Taxi service from Täsch.
DetailsTrains run directly to car-free Zermatt. A trip to Zermatt by automobile ends 5 km away in Täsch. Then it continues by shuttle train or by taxi to the resort at the foot of the Matterhorn.
DetailsThe Matterhorn Terminal Täsch has 2,100 covered parking spaces (131 of which are in a separate E-Zone with its own charging stations) available 24 hours a day, 365 days a year. Visitors can park their vehicle here and take the rail shuttle to Zermatt.
DetailsZermatt is car-free. Access by private car is only permitted to Täsch. From Täsch, one continues to Zermatt by train or by taxi or limousine service.
DetailsThose who arrive by automobile can change to the Zermatt shuttle train in Täsch. With this, they are conveniently in auto-free Zermatt in 12 minutes. The shuttle trains depart every 20 minutes. Alternative to the trip from Täsch to Zermatt: taxi from Täsch.
DetailsThe Zermatt electric bus has a characteristic shape, is powered without a combustion engine, does not produce any emissions, is locally produced as a unique item and has become synonymous with mobility in the village. The Matterhorn spa resort has always been “car-free” even if there is still traffic. Yet pedestrians rule in the narrow streets of Zermatt, under Section 3 of local traffic regulations.
DetailsThe Glacier Express carries guests in comfortable panorama cars through the most beautiful areas of the Alps. From St. Moritz to Zermatt. During this journey, it crosses 291 bridges and goes through 91 tunnels.
